- This invention relates to a device for interior wall installation in building construction.
- CH-A-577,612 shows an arrangement using metal uprights in conjunction with an elongate metal pressing which acts as a combination baseboard and board support.
- the metal uprights must be individually located and secured to floor and ceiling.
- US-A-1,981,239 makes use of a continuous base plate which is secured to the floor and is provided with means for locating metal studs. A number of discrete elements are then secured to the base plate and/or the studs; these elements may include a channel section for supporting a drywall board, and a baseboard. This arrangement uses a considerable number of separate parts and would be time consuming to erect.
- the invention accordingly provides a wall mounting device comprising an elongate base plate, a side flange extending from one side of the base plate and having a free edge turned in and shaped to form an elongate channel extending longitudinally of the base plate and in spaced relation therewith, the channel opening in a direction normal to the base plate and outwardly therefrom to receive an edge of a planar sheet, and the outer surface of the flange forming a decorative trim in the finished construction of the wall, characterised in that the base plate, the flange and the channel are integrally formed to provide a unitary structure, and in that the base plate extends laterally of the channel a sufficient distance to permit a plurality of wall studs to be positioned spaced along the device with each stud bearing on the base plate and fixed laterally to a channel wall of the channel.
- the example embodiments of the invention shown in the drawings each consist of an interior wall mounting device comprising a ceiling element 12, floor element 14, a door element 16, and a window element 18.
- Ceiling element 12 shown in Figure 2, consists of a base plate 20 having, extending therefrom, a pair of space side flanges 22, terminating in a pair of downwardly opening channels 24 which are spaced apart a distance corresponding to the thickness of a wall stud 33.
- Channels 24 are each defined by a downwardly projecting outer side wall 26 contiguous with the side flange, a bottom 27 and an inner side wall 28 lying in a plane normal to the base plate.
- Base plate 20 and inner side wall 28 carry apertures 30 and 32 respectively for receiving fastening elements 34 which are shown as screws.
- Floor element 14 shown in Figure 3, consists of a base plate 36 having, extending therefrom, a pair of spaced side flanges 38 terminating in a pair of upwardly opening channels 40 which are space apart a distance corresponding to the thickness of wall stud 33.
- Channels 40 are each defined by an upwardly projecting inner side wall 42, a bottom 43, and an upwardly projecting outer side wall 44 contiguous with the side flange.
- Base plate 36 and inner plate 42 carry apertures 46 and 48 respectively for receiving fastening elements 34.
- a door frame element 16 is shown in Figure 4 and consists of a face plate 50 having, extending therefrom, a pair of side flanges 51, each terminating in a channel 52, the channels being spaced apart a distance corresponding to the thickness of wall stud 33.
- Channels 52 are each defined by an outer side wall 56 contiguous with the side flange, a bottom 57, and an inner side wall 58 lying in a plane normal to the base plate lying against wall stud 33.
- the outer end of inner side wall 58 of each channel 52 terminates in a channel extension plate 60.
- a stop 64 projects from face plate 50 and protrudes into the door area, with an abutment face 66 parallel to the face of a closed door 68.
- Channel extension plates 54 carry apertures 68 for receiving fastening elements 34.
- a window frame element 18 shown in Figure 5 consists of a face plate 70 adjacent the window having, extending therefrom, a pair of side flanges 72 spaced apart a predetermined distance and terminating in a pair of channels 74. Extending from face plate 70 opposite side flanges 72 is a window receiving channel 73. Face plate 70 and window receiving channel 73 carry receiving apertures 75 and 752 respectively for receiving fastening elements 34.
- Channels 74 are each defined by an outer side wall 76 contiguous with the side flange, a bottom 77, and an inner side wall 78 lying in a plane normal to the base plate. Inner side wall 78 of channel 74 carries apertures 82 for receiving fastening elements 34.
- ceiling element 12 is fastened by screws 34 to ceiling 31 through apertures 30.
- Floor element 14 is aligned vertically with ceiling element 12 and fastened to floor 35 by screws 34 through apertures 46.
- the ends of vertical wall studs 33 are located in these elements in the usual manner.
- ceiling element 12 and floor element 14 are securely fastened by screws 34 to wall studs 33 through apertures 32 for ceiling element 12 and aperture 48 for floor element 14.
- door element 16 and window element 18 are fastened to wall studs 33 by screws 34 through aperture 68 for door element 16 and aperture 82.

- the floor, ceiling, door, and window elements of the wall mounting device may be preformed into various shapes which may be especially efficient when used to construct closets or showers; otherwise they may be roll formed on the site.
- the various elements may be roll formed from any suitable material such as sheet metal or aluminum, or the elements may be formed by using various plastics in appropriate moulds. Also the side flanges of the various elements may be pre-finished with suitable materials such as marble, paint, or plastics.
- wall substrate refers to sheet materials such as drywall, gyproc, pressboard, and panelling.

- Dispositif à montage en paroi comprenant une plaque de base (20, 36) allongée, un rebord latéral (22, 38) s'étendant depuis un côté de la plaque de base et ayant un bord libre tourné et configuré pour former un canal (24, 40) allongé s'étendant dans la direction longitudinale de la plaque de base et en relation d'espacement vis-à-vis d'elle, le canal (24, 40) s'ouvrant dans une direction perpendiculaire par rapport à la plaque de base (20, 36) et en direction de l'extérieur de celle-ci, pour recevoir un bord d'une feuille (81) plane, et la surface extérieure du rebord (22, 38) formant une bordure décorative lorsque la construction de la paroi est terminée, caractérisé par le fait que la plaque de base (20, 36), le rebord (22, 38) et le canal (24, 40) sont réalisés d'un seul tenant pour constituer une structure unitaire (12, 24), et que la plaque de base (20, 36) s'étend sur le côté du canal (24, 40), sur une distance suffisante pour permettre à une pluralité de tenons de paroi (33) d'être positionnés selon un certain nombre d'espacements le long du dispositif, chaque tenon (33) portant sur la plaque de base (20, 36) et étant fixé latéralement à une paroi de canal (28, 42) du canal (24, 40).
- Dispositif selon la revendication 1, dans lequel le rebord (38) constitue un panneau de base.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 1, dans lequel le rebord (22) constitue une corniche.
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 3, comprenant un deuxième rebord (22, 38) s'étendant depuis l'autre côté de la plaque de base (20, 36) et tourné et configuré pour former un deuxième canal allongé (24, 40) s'étendant dans la direction longitudinale de la plaque de base (20, 36) et en relation d'espacement avec celle-ci, le deuxième canal (24, 40) s'ouvrant dans une direction perpendiculaire par rapport à la plaque de base (20, 36) et en direction de l'extérieur de celle-ci, pour recevoir un bord d'une deuxième feuille (81) plane, et la surface extérieure du deuxième rebord (22, 38) formant une bordure décorative lorsque la construction de la paroi est terminée, le deuxième rebord (22, 38) et le deuxième canal (24, 40) étant réalisés d'un seul tenant avec les autres éléments, pour constituer une structure unitaire (12, 24), l'espacement existant entre lesdits canaux (24, 40) étant tel que lesdits tenons (33) peuvent être assurés auxdites parois latérales (28, 42) desdits deux canaux (24, 40).
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, dans lequel la plaque de base (20, 36) est susceptible d'être fixée à une structure support (31, 35), par l'intermédiaire d'une pluralité d'ouvertures (46, 30) ménagées dans la plaque de base (20, 36).
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, dans lequel le dispositif est susceptible d'être fixé aux tenons (33), par l'intermédiaire d'une pluralité d'ouvertures (48, 32) ménagées dans la paroi latérale intérieure (28, 42) de chaque canal (24, 40).
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, positionné sur un plancher à titre d'élément de plancher (14), en combinaison avec un deuxième dispositif de montage en paroi, sel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, positionné sur un plafond en tant qu'élément plafond (12), les éléments plancher (14) et plafond (12) étant alignés verticalement l'un au-dessus de l'autre pour recevoir des tenons (33) allant du plancher au plafond et portant sur leurs plaques de base (36, 20) et des feuilles planes (81) logées dans leurs canaux (40, 24) alignés.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 7, dans lequel l'élément plancher (14) comprend une paire de panneaux de base espacés parallèlement et l'élément plafond (12) comprend une paire de corniches espacées parallèlement, de manière que la pluralité de tenons verticaux puissent être logés entre les canaux (24, 40) de chaque élément et y être fixés, et une paire de feuilles planes (81) étant susceptible d'être logée dans les canaux (24, 40) et d'être fixée contre les tenons pour former une paroi double.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 7 ou la revendication 8, dans lequel les éléments plancher et plafond comprennent chacun un panneau de base et une corniche unique, respectivement, et chaque élément plafond et plancher a un canal unique, lesdits rebords latéraux reliant lesdits canaux à une extrémité des plaques de base des éléments plancher et plafond et dans lequel est relié à l'autre extrémité de la plaque de base une plaque reposoir (146), s'étendant sensiblement perpendiculairement par rapport à sa plaque de base respective et placée pour venir en butée sur les tenons, du côté éloigné du rebord latéral.
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 6, dans lequel un rebord latéral unique relie un canal à la plaque de base, à une extrémité de la plaque de base, et comporte une plaque reposoir (146) reliée à l'autre extrémité de la plaque de base, la plaque reposoir s'étendant sensiblement perpendiculairement par rapport à la plaque de base et étant située pour venir en butée sur les tenons, portant sur la plaque de base, du côté des tenons qui est éloigné du rebord.
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 6, comprenant des moyens de saisie de tapis-moquette (82) comprenant une extension extérieure de la plaque de base (20, 36), les moyens (92) portant l'extension saisissant un tapis-moquette placé sur l'extension.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 11, dans lequel l'extension est constituée par une plaque (86) séparée supplémentaire contiguè à la plaque de base (20, 36) et comprenant des moyens (88, 96) destinés à ancrer ladite plaque supplémentaire à la plaque de base.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 12, dans lequel les moyens d'ancrage de ladite plaque supplémentaire à la plaque de base comprennent une pluralité de barbelés (88) s'étendant vers le haut depuis ladite plaque supplémentaire, la plaque de base comprenant une pluralité d'ouvertures (96) destinées à recevoir les barbelés (88).
- Dispositif selon la revendication 12 ou la revendication 13, dans lequel ladite plaque supplémentaire comprend un rail de positionnement (90), montant à partir d'elle et placée selon un espacement par rapport à ses bords latéraux.
- Dispositif sel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 6, dans lequel la plaque de base (20, 36) comprend un épaulement longitudinal partant de celle-ci, pour former une butée de porte (64).
- Dispositif selon la revendication 1, dans lequel ladite paroi de canal est une paroi latérale intérieure (58) située dans un plan perpendiculaire à la plaque de base, servant à la mise en butée des premiers côtés de la pluralité des tenons, l'extrémité distale de la paroi latérale intérieure ayant une plaque d'extension pour canal, dépendant de la paroi latéral intérieure et sensiblement perpendiculaire à la paroi latérale intérieure du canal, pour venir en butée sur un deuxième côté de la pluralité de tenons et la plaque d'extension pour canal ayant une pluralité d'ouvertures (68) à travers lesquelles la plaque d'extension pour canal peut être fixée à la pluralité de tenons.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 1, dans lequel la plaque de base (20, 36) porte un canal (73), tourné vers l'extérieur de celle-ci et adapté pour recevoir un bord d'un panneau de vitre de fenêtre.
- Dispositif selon la revendication 7, dans lequel au moins un bord latéral de la plaque de base (20) de l'élément plafond (12) est creusé latéralement pour former une corniche (223).
- Dispositif selon la revendication 4, dans lequel la plaque de base (20, 36) est creusée sur les deux bords latéraux pour constituer une paire de corniches (223) s'ouvrant dans des directions opposées l'un à l'autre et perpendiculairement par rapport aux ouvertures des canaux (24, 40).
